COMMON COUNCIL
of the
CITY OF SYRACUSE
REGULAR MEETING –OCTOBER 23, 2017
1:00 P.M. / (10/23) / (xx)
1. /

Pledge of Allegiance to the Flag – (Led by Hon. Van B. Robinson, President of the Syracuse Common Council)

2. /

Invocation-– (Delivered by Reverend Joseph Dowell, of Fountain of Love Ministries, Syracuse, New York)

3. /

Roll Call – (Present – 8; Councilor Boyle - Absent)

4. /

Minutes –October 10, 2017 - (Adopted 8-0)

5. / Petitions–(A petition containing signatures from 68 City Residents expressing concerns over the proposed development of a grocery store and convenience store at 4700 S. Salina St; A petition with 9 signatures from the residents of the 300 block of Primrose Ave., urging for the installation of a police security camera at the end of Primrose Ave.)
6. / Committee Reports –(Public Works (D.P.W. & Transportation); Public Safety).
7. /

Communications- (From JC Land Fund, LLC, a letter accepting the terms and conditions of Ord. 729-2017 (09/11/2017); From Monique Cooper, a letter accepting the terms and conditions of Ord. 772 (09/25/17).

BY COUNCILOR THOMPSON, PRESIDENT ROBINSON AND ALL COUNCILORS:
13.
8-0 / Resolution – Memorializing United States Senators Schumer and Gillibrand and Congressman John Katko to retain state and local tax exemptions (SALT) in any tax bill considered by the United States Congress. SALT is a crucial federal tax deduction which is relied upon by many hard working men and woman in the City of Syracuse, and if repealed would further put Syracuse and New York State at a competitive disadvantage. / 34-R

BY COUNCILOR MAROUN:
86.
H / Authorize - An Exemption Agreement with Clinton Landing Housing Development Fund Company, Inc., (the “Corporation”) pursuant to Section 573 and Section 577 of Article 11 of the New York Private Housing Finance Law and Section 402 of the New York Not-For-Profit Corporation Law, to construct affordable, permanent supportive housing units (the “Facility”) for persons transitioning out of shelter. The project will be located on the northwest corner of South Clinton Street and Taylor Street. The term would be for the period of 15 years and each year based on the standard shelter rent formula (10% of the difference between gross rents minus utilities, or $25,000, whichever is greater). / H
